Discovering Cagliari’s Old Town and Marina

The tour kicks off with a gentle cruise through Cagliari’s Marina district, where you can admire the colorful boats bobbing in the harbor and the bustling cafes. This area is perfect for getting a feel for daily life in Cagliari. As you pedal through the streets, your guide will point out notable sights and weave in fascinating stories about the city’s maritime history.

Next, you’ll venture into Villanova, a neighborhood that offers a more relaxed, flower-filled ambiance. The cobblestone streets and charming squares here give you a sense of the city’s quieter, more intimate side. I loved how the guide’s commentary makes each alley and corner come alive — from anecdotes about local families to historical tidbits.

Historic Landmarks and Architectural Gems

The real highlight is the Castello district, perched atop a hill that’s accessible easily thanks to the e-bike. You’ll see the ancient city walls, Pisan towers, and bastions, each telling a story of Sardinia’s complex past. The Roman Amphitheater, visible from certain vantage points, provides a glimpse into the city’s ancient roots, and many reviews mention how impressive the views are from here.

FAQ

Cagliari: 2-Hour Guided E-Bike Tour with Coffee - FAQ

Is this tour suitable for people who are not experienced cyclists?
Yes. The e-bikes make pedaling easier, and the guides are attentive to safety and comfort. It’s designed for a range of fitness levels, but note that some reviews suggest you need to be comfortable riding in city traffic.

How long does the tour last?
The tour lasts around 2 hours, with a start time that varies depending on availability. It ends back at the starting point, so you don’t need to worry about transportation afterward.

What’s included in the price?
Your fee covers a guided tour with a local expert, bike rental, and one coffee at a local café. All are included in the $54.66 price.

Can I cancel the tour if my plans change?
Yes. You can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, giving you flexibility in planning.

Is there a minimum age or height requirement?
Yes. The tour is not suitable for children under 4 ft 3 in (130 cm) or over 6 ft 6 in (200 cm). It also isn’t recommended for those over 75 years old or over 287 lbs (130 kg).

Where does the tour start and end?
It begins at the NewWaySardinia bike rental shop in the city center and ends back at the same location, making logistics simple and convenient.
